Matthew Kolakowski was shopping with his daughter at a Michigan Walmart when he heard screams and saw a man with a knife.
Police are seeking to charge 42-year-old Bradford James Gille with terrorism and assault with intent to murder charges after he allegedly stabbed 11 people in a Michigan Walmart store.
"I'm still sitting and grappling with the weight of realizing that it was kind of a life-or-death moment," said Julia Martell, who witnessed the stabbing, which wounded 11 people.
